The name 'Bozlur' is believed to derive from Turkic roots combining 'boz,' meaning 'grey' or 'wild,' and 'lur,' a suffix denoting presence or essence. Historically, it evokes the image of a steadfast protector or warrior, symbolizing strength and resilience in the face of adversity. Its use in Central Asian cultures highlights its connection to nature and courage.

Cultural Significance of Bozlur

Bozlur carries deep cultural significance in Turkic and Central Asian traditions, symbolizing strength, protection, and connection to the wild grey steppe landscapes. Historically, it has been associated with warriors and leaders who embodied bravery and resilience. The name evokes nature and valor, often passed down through generations in communities valuing honor and steadfastness.
